  • Publication number: 20060004537
    Abstract: In one embodiment a memory controller is provided. The memory controller comprises a predictive logic circuit to predict an increase in a current operating temperature of a memory device coupled to the memory controller, based on memory cycles to be issued to the memory device; and a temperature control circuit to perform a temperature control operation wherein if the sum of the current operating temperature and the predicted increase in temperature is greater than a threshold temperature associated with the memory device, then the number of memory cycles issued to the memory device is reduced.

  • Publication number: 20040215912
    Abstract: A method is described that entails reading information from a non volatile storage or memory resource. The information is a threshold or information from which a threshold can be calculated. The information is particularly tailored for an operating environment that a system memory is recognized as being subjected to. The method also entails causing a memory controller to employ the threshold so as to control a rate at which the memory performs activities.

  • Patent number: 6453218
    Abstract: A method and apparatus for the thermal sensing and regulating of a RAM device using temperature sensing circuitry, embedded directly in the device, is presented. A predetermined voltage is passed through a temperature sensitive diode to create an analog signal. The analog signal is converted into digital temperature data by a A/D converter. The digital temperature data is then transmitted to a controlling host, without interfering with the normal operation of the device, by either transmitting the data in an out-of-band signal or during the clock refresh cycle. The controlling host, upon receipt of the temperature data, checks to see if the temperature level of the device has exceeded a threshold value.
